Types of Window Damage
Understanding the numerous kinds of damage that can take place is crucial for determining the suitable repair approach.
1.1 Cracked or Broken Glass
Broken Glass Repair or shattered glass is among the most typical window concerns. This damage can take place due to severe weather condition, an object striking the window, or perhaps thermal stress.
1.2 Window Frame Damage
Wood frames can rot or warp, while metal frames may corrode. Frame damage compromises the window's structural integrity and can lead to more considerable concerns if not attended to.
1.3 Seal Failure
Double-pane and triple-pane windows have sealant that keeps the insulating gas between the panes. If the seal stops working, condensation can form in between the panes, causing foggy windows and decreased energy efficiency.
1.4 Sash Problems
Sashes hold the glass panes in location. Typical concerns consist of misalignment, problem opening or closing, or persistent drafts. These issues can impact security and energy performance.

Fundamental Repair Techniques
When resolving window damage, homeowners have several choices varying from DIY repair work to working with professionals. Here's a better take a look at these methods.
2.1 DIY Repairs
Property owners with fundamental handyman abilities can take on specific repairs:
Replacing Glass: For cracked glass, thoroughly eliminate the broken pieces and install a brand-new pane utilizing glazing putty. Safety gear is necessary.Frame Repairs: For minor frame problems, sanding and repainting wood frames or using rust-resistant paint on metal frames can revitalize the look and extend life.Sash Repair: Lubricating or realigning sashes can deal with functional issues and enhance performance.2.2 Professional Repair Options

4. Often Asked Questions (FAQs)Q1: How do I know if my window requires repair or replacement?
A1: If the damage is shallow, repairs can be adequate. Nevertheless, if the frame is decomposing or the glass is shattered, replacement may be the best alternative.
Q2: Is it possible to repair window seals myself?
A2: While some minor seal issues can be addressed with DIY approaches, professional aid is advised for long-term solutions.
Q3: What tools do I require for a DIY window repair?
A3: A standard toolkit including security glasses, gloves, glazing putty, an energy knife, and a putty knife can assist with simple repairs.
Q4: How often should I check my windows?
A4: Homeowners must examine their windows a minimum of when a year, searching for indications of damage or wear.
Q5: Are there any indications that indicate I require a professional?
A5: Difficulty opening or closing the window, significant drafts, or visual condensation between panes are indications that professional intervention is required.
